How to Stock Your Pantry for Paleo Meal Prep

Are you ready to take your Paleo meal prep to the next level? Stocking your pantry with the right ingredients is the key to success! Here are some tips to help you get started:

1. Stock up on healthy fats. Healthy fats are essential for a Paleo diet, so make sure you have plenty of olive oil, coconut oil, and avocado oil on hand. You can also add some grass-fed butter and ghee for added flavor.

2. Get your protein. Protein is an important part of a Paleo diet, so make sure you have plenty of grass-fed beef, wild-caught fish, and pasture-raised poultry in your pantry. You can also add some nuts and seeds for a protein boost.

3. Load up on veggies. Veggies are a great source of vitamins and minerals, so make sure you have plenty of fresh and frozen vegetables in your pantry. You can also add some canned vegetables for convenience.

4. Don’t forget the fruits. Fruits are a great source of fiber and antioxidants, so make sure you have plenty of fresh and frozen fruits in your pantry. You can also add some dried fruits for a sweet treat.

5. Get your carbs. Carbs are an important part of a Paleo diet, so make sure you have plenty of sweet potatoes, yams, and plantains in your pantry. You can also add some nuts and seeds for a carb boost.
